What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13):  Each employee eng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et or more above lower levels was not protected by guardrail systems, safety net systems, or personal fall arrest systems, nor were the employee(s) provided with an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501(b):      a)  On August 18, 2016, employees were exposed to fall hazards of up to approximately 15 feet while performing stucco work to a new single family home.

29 CFR 1926.503(a)(1):  The employer did not provide a training program for each employee potentially exposed to fall hazards to enable each employee to recognize the hazards of falling and the procedures to be followed in order to minimize these hazards:     a)  On or about August 18, 2016, employees were exposed to fall hazards while performing stucco work and the employer did not provide a training program to recognize fall hazards and the procedures to be followed in order to minimize those hazards.
